What Would a Vladimir Guerrero Jr. Trade Package Look Like?

So, if this hypothetical Vladimir Guerrero Jr. trade were to actually happen, what would the New York Yankees have to give up? Buckle up, guys, because this isn't going to be cheap. We're talking about acquiring one of the premier offensive talents in Major League Baseball. The Blue Jays would demand a king's ransom, and rightfully so. For the Yankees, this would likely mean parting with some of their top prospects. Think about the names that always come up in trade discussions: Jasson Dominguez is almost certainly off-limits, but perhaps someone like Spencer Jones or other highly-rated outfielders or pitchers in their system could be involved. It's not just about quantity; it's about quality. The Blue Jays would want players who are close to MLB-ready or who have shown elite potential in the minor leagues. It might also require packaging multiple prospects, possibly including a young, controllable pitcher who could slot into the Blue Jays' rotation and give them an impact player for years to come. On top of prospects, the Yankees might also have to include a current major league player, perhaps someone with a solid contract who can provide immediate big-league production, to help the Blue Jays fill an immediate roster need. The Blue Jays are unlikely to trade Vlad Jr. solely for prospects; they'll want established talent as well. This would push the Yankees to potentially re-evaluate their roster construction and decide which pieces they are willing to sacrifice for that superstar power bat. The financial implications would also be a factor; Vlad Jr. is still under team control for a few more years, so the Yankees would be acquiring him not just for the immediate future but for the long haul. This high price tag reflects Vlad Jr.'s immense value and the significant impact he could have on a team's fortunes. It's a deal that would require a major overhaul of the Yankees' farm system and potentially some tough decisions regarding their current roster.

The Reality Check: Are These Trade Rumors Likely?

Okay, let's bring it back down to earth for a second. While the idea of Vladimir Guerrero Jr. in pinstripes is exciting, we need to talk about the reality of these trade rumors. It's important to remember that MLB trade rumors are a dime a dozen, especially during the offseason or leading up to the trade deadline. Many of these discussions are fueled by speculation, fan desires, and sometimes, by agents trying to drum up interest in their clients. For a trade of this magnitude to happen, there needs to be mutual interest between the teams, and the asking price has to be something the acquiring team is willing and able to meet. The Blue Jays are in an interesting spot; they've had ups and downs, and while they might listen to offers for almost anyone, trading away a player as significant as Vlad Jr. would require a monumental return that significantly accelerates their timeline or provides long-term stability. The Yankees, while aggressive, also have their own prospect pool and organizational philosophy to consider. Are they willing to gut their farm system for one player, even one as talented as Guerrero Jr.? It’s a tough call. Furthermore, Vlad Jr. is still under team control, meaning the Blue Jays have leverage. They don't have to trade him. They could wait until he gets closer to free agency or decide to build around him. So, while it’s fun to imagine, it’s crucial to approach these rumors with a healthy dose of skepticism. There are many hurdles to overcome, including the Blue Jays' asking price, the Yankees' willingness to part with their top talent, and the overall strategic direction of both franchises. It’s more likely that these are just speculative discussions rather than concrete negotiations at this stage.
